Foundation Construction in Greenville, SC
Foundation construction services encompass the planning, design, and implementation of the structural base that supports residential and commercial properties. These services are essential for new construction projects, including homes, garages, and additions, as well as for repairing or reinforcing existing foundations that may have experienced shifting or damage. Property owners typically seek foundation construction to ensure stability, prevent settling issues, and protect the integrity of the entire structure. Before requesting this service, it’s important to understand the type of foundation suitable for the property,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, and to consider site-specific factors like soil conditions and drainage.
Homeowners and property owners often want to know about the scope of work involved, including excavation, footing installation, and concrete pouring, as well as the potential need for soil testing or reinforcement. Clarifying the extent of the project helps determine the right approach and materials. Understanding the property’s unique characteristics and any existing issues can contribute to a successful foundation build or repair, providing long-term stability and peace of mind for the property’s safety and value.

Common Foundation Construction Jobs
Foundation Repair - addresses cracks and settling issues to stabilize a home’s structure.
Basement Foundations - involves pouring concrete or installing block walls to create a strong underground base.
Pier and Beam Foundations - elevates homes on piers to prevent moisture damage and improve stability.
Slab Foundations - provides a solid concrete base for homes built on level ground.
Underpinning Services - strengthen existing foundations to support additional loads or correct settlement.
Foundation Wa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ects foundations from moisture damage.
Foundation Construction Questions
What types of foundation construction services are available? Services include new foundation installation, underpinning, and repairs for various property types in Greenville and nearby areas.
When is foundation construction needed? Foundation work is typically required when there are signs of settling, cracks, or other structural issues affecting stability.
What materials are used in foundation construction? Common materials include concrete, steel reinforcement, and sometimes masonry, depending on the project requirements.
How does the foundation type vary for different properties? The foundation type is chosen based on soil conditions, property size, and load requirements, such as slab, crawl space, or basement foundations.
